[mips][mips64r6] [sl][duw]xc1 are not available on MIPS32r6/MIPS64r6
Summary: Folded mips64-fp-indexed-ls.ll into fp-indexed-ls.ll. To do so, the zext's in mips64-fp-indexed-ls.ll were changed to implicit sign extensions (performed by getelementptr). This does not affect the purpose of the test.
